agent-ecosystem/src/features
2026-05-26 01:08:18 +03:00
..
agent-attachments fix: remove redundant image mime alias 2026-05-26 01:08:18 +03:00
agent-graph feat(i18n): add localization foundation 2026-05-24 15:37:24 +03:00
anthropic-runtime-profile fix(team): align Anthropic effort UI fallback 2026-05-19 21:27:50 +03:00
codex-account feat: improve provider status startup hydration 2026-05-24 00:23:04 +03:00
codex-model-catalog feat: prefer orchestrator codex model catalog 2026-04-28 20:13:03 +03:00
codex-runtime-installer fix(ci): stabilize runtime release checks 2026-05-22 00:55:29 +03:00
codex-runtime-profile feat(team): expand opencode review and release support 2026-04-24 12:05:54 +03:00
localization feat(team): support sent message revisions 2026-05-25 21:11:59 +03:00
member-log-stream feat(team): support sent message revisions 2026-05-25 21:11:59 +03:00
member-work-sync revert: revert KiloCode provider support 2026-05-25 21:19:56 +03:00
recent-projects feat(i18n): add localization foundation 2026-05-24 15:37:24 +03:00
running-teams feat(i18n): add localization foundation 2026-05-24 15:37:24 +03:00
runtime-provider-management revert: revert KiloCode provider support 2026-05-25 21:19:56 +03:00
team-runtime-lanes feat(graph): refine runtime lanes and model compatibility 2026-05-19 14:24:30 +03:00
tmux-installer feat(i18n): add localization foundation 2026-05-24 15:37:24 +03:00
workspace-trust fix(workspace-trust): canonicalize git worktree trust roots 2026-05-25 21:30:56 +03:00
CLAUDE.md fix(team): harden opencode delivery recovery 2026-05-14 15:11:40 +03:00
README.md fix(team): harden opencode delivery recovery 2026-05-14 15:11:40 +03:00

Features

This directory contains the canonical home for medium and large feature slices.

Before creating or refactoring a feature, read:

Reference examples:

  • recent-projects - full cross-process feature with contracts, core, main, preload, renderer, and focused tests
  • agent-graph - thin feature with core/domain and renderer integration only
  • codex-model-catalog and team-runtime-lanes - process-limited features that omit renderer or preload layers when they do not own those boundaries

Use src/features/<feature-name>/ by default when the work introduces:

  • a new use case or business policy
  • transport wiring
  • more than one process boundary
  • more than one adapter or provider

Feature-local docs should answer navigation questions:

  • which shape the feature uses
  • which entrypoints are public
  • where new adapters, rules, bridges, or renderer surfaces belong
  • what tests protect the behavior
  • which local files are the best examples for future changes

Do not duplicate architecture rules in feature folders. Keep the standard centralized in ../../docs/FEATURE_ARCHITECTURE_STANDARD.md.

Rule of thumb:

  • recent-projects is the full slice example with process-aware outer layers
  • agent-graph is the thin slice example built around core/ plus renderer/